One notable catalyst for this shift is the rise of technologies designed to minimize the ecological footprint of the tourism sector. For instance, the advent of sustainable materials and smart architectural designs has led to the creation of eco-lodges and hotels that blend seamlessly into their surroundings. These structures utilize renewable energy sources, promote the circular economy, and ensure minimal disturbance to local wildlife. Such innovations are essential in creating an experience that is both luxurious and environmentally responsible.
In addition to infrastructure, transportation plays a pivotal role in the sustainability narrative. Traditional means of transit, often marred by pollution and congestion, are being replaced or enhanced with greener alternatives. Electric vehicles, hybrid buses, and even bicycle-sharing programs are gaining traction, offering travelers eco-conscious options. Furthermore, initiatives promoting walkability in urban destinations not only reduce carbon emissions but also allow tourists to immerse themselves in the local culture in an authentic manner.

Community engagement is another critical facet of sustainable tourism. Visitors increasingly favor experiences that connect them to the local populace, fostering a shared experience that benefits both tourists and residents alike. This can manifest in various forms, from culinary workshops featuring local ingredients to artisan craft sessions. When travelers invest their time and resources in authentic interactions, they contribute to the preservation of cultural heritage, ensuring that traditional practices are not lost to the tide of globalization.
Moreover, responsible tourism encourages the patronage of businesses that prioritize sustainability. Choosing to support establishments committed to community welfare and ecological preservation is a powerful way to amplify positive impacts.
